Patent · US Expired

Method for optimizing the performance of a database

US6606618B2 · kind B2 · utility

31Cited by
10References
18Claims
0Family size

Assignee

Inventor

Key dates

Filing dateFeb 23, 2001
Grant dateAug 12, 2003
Priority date
Expiry dateJun 9, 2021

Classification

  • Technology area (CPC Y)Emerging Cross-Sectional Technologies
  • CPC primaryY10S707/99952
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A relational installation database for storing data elements in the form of strings, objects, etc. is aliased with integer identifiers corresponding to each data element is disclosed. The integer identifiers are obtained from an index that sequentially stores a copy of each unique occurrences of a data element. Populating an installation database with only integers reduces persistent size and provides uniformity to the data fields underlying the database tables, and provides a significant improvement in database performance The uniform data fields may be expanded and contracted to add temporary rows and columns directly to a database table. Database tables may be created in a modular fashion and may be efficiently merged together when the software product is complete. Also, differences between various versions of the software product may be recorded in database transforms.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.